The mom of a neighborhood tennis star joined Los Angeles County prosecutors on Monday in calling for stricter DUI penalties in California after they are saying her son was killed by a two-time drunk driver.
Braun Levi, an 18-year-old South Bay tennis standout, was struck and killed by a automobile within the early-morning hours of Might 4 in Manhattan Seaside.
In accordance with Los Angeles County prosecutors, 33-year-old Jenia Resha Belt was behind the wheel, rushing whereas driving on a suspended license and with a blood alcohol degree nearly twice the authorized restrict. Belt, prosecutors say, has a earlier conviction for driving drunk.
“California’s present DUI legal guidelines are damaged and weak and fail to guard households like ours, and it’s devastating,” Braun’s mom, Jennifer Levi, stated at a information convention Monday. “His dying haunts my each breath, every single day.”

The SoCal athlete, who died a month earlier than his highschool commencement after coming into the highest nationwide ranks in boys tennis, is an element of a bigger development of DUI-related deaths during the last 15 years, based on a CalMatters investigative sequence that L.A. Dist. Atty. Nathan J. Hochman referenced.
Roadway deaths have been steadily rising since 2010, partially on account of repeat drunk drivers and folks driving over the velocity restrict, CalMatters reported. Alcohol-related deaths have elevated by 50% during the last decade, based on the investigation.

California’s DUI legal guidelines, though thought-about to be nation-leading within the Eighties, have fallen behind the curve, Hochman stated.
Hochman warned drivers, particularly forward of the New 12 months’s vacation, that his workplace would proceed to cost them — and doubtlessly those that overserve alcohol at bars or events — with severe crimes.
“We’re right here to forestall crimes and ship crystal clear messages to would-be drunk and drug drivers, to individuals who wish to have interaction in extreme velocity on our roads: We are going to come after you,” Hochman stated, calling the problem a “combat for folks’s lives.”
Belt is charged with second-degree homicide, felony gross vehicular manslaughter whereas intoxicated and a misdemeanor depend of driving with a suspended license after a DUI. She is being held on $2-million bail and faces life in jail if convicted.
Belt’s arraignment is scheduled for Jan. 13.
